Transaction fa7c788a1120ddcc3bfe45292c6104585200511cca63fd6ffcb48c890dea23c5
3 Input
1 Outputs
- fa7c788a1120ddcc3bfe45292c6104585200511cca63fd6ffcb48c890dea23c5:0
value 2654114
address 1Ci6iGADwLzoHPA6Td2RZSqUYkqCZA69Wt